news 2026/7/2 17:41:24

10款高颜值Zsh主题:让你的终端颜值爆表,效率翻倍!

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
10款高颜值Zsh主题:让你的终端颜值爆表,效率翻倍!

10款高颜值Zsh主题:让你的终端颜值爆表,效率翻倍!

【免费下载链接】ohmyzsh项目地址: https://gitcode.com/gh_mirrors/ohmy/ohmyzsh

终端美化是提升开发体验的关键一步,一个精心设计的Zsh主题能让你的命令行工作变得更加愉悦高效。今天为大家精选10款风格各异的ohmyzsh主题,无论你是新手还是资深开发者,都能找到适合自己的那一款。

极速响应型主题

robbyrussell - 简约高效之选

作为ohmyzsh的默认主题,robbyrussell以其极简设计深受喜爱。仅显示当前目录和Git状态,色彩对比鲜明,启动速度快,兼容性极佳。

clean - 纯净无干扰

clean主题如其名,完全去除所有多余信息,只保留最基本提示符。适合需要专注编程或写作的场景,让你的注意力完全集中在任务上。

沉浸式体验主题

agnoster - Powerline风格代表

agnoster采用分段式设计,通过色彩区块直观展示用户、主机、目录等信息。视觉效果出色,信息分层清晰,需要安装Powerline字体支持特殊符号显示。

ys - 全面信息掌控

ys主题以垂直布局展示丰富信息,包括用户、主机、Git状态、虚拟环境和时间戳。甚至显示上一条命令的退出码,适合需要全面了解系统状态的高级用户。

信息可视化主题

gnzh - 双行优雅布局

gnzh主题采用双行设计,上行为系统信息栏,下行为命令输入区。通过Unicode线条分隔视觉区域,SSH连接时自动将主机名标红,提升远程操作安全性。

fishy - Fish风格移植

fishy主题将Fish shell的默认prompt移植到ohmyzsh,采用路径折叠技术,长路径自动缩写。右侧显示Git状态图标,界面美观且实用。

主题对比矩阵

主题名称信息密度启动速度适用场景
robbyrussell极快日常开发、新手入门
agnoster中等演示分享、视觉需求高
ys极高较慢系统监控、高级用户
clean极低极快专注工作、写作场景
gnzh中等远程操作、双屏工作

主题选择决策路径

根据你的需求选择合适的主题:

  • 追求速度:robbyrussell、clean
  • 需要信息:ys、gnzh
  • 注重美观:agnoster、fishy

实用配置技巧

一键切换主题

编辑你的zsh配置文件,修改ZSH_THEME变量即可快速切换:

# 设置为agnoster主题 ZSH_THEME="agnoster" # 设置为clean主题 ZSH_THEME="clean"

字体安装指南

部分主题需要特殊字体支持:

# Ubuntu/Debian系统 sudo apt install fonts-powerline # macOS系统 brew install font-powerline

场景化推荐组合

使用场景推荐主题核心优势
日常开发robbyrussell简洁高效,兼容性好
远程服务器ys信息全面,包含退出码
演示分享agnoster视觉冲击力强,信息分层清晰
专注工作clean无干扰设计,减少视觉噪音

进阶美化方案

自定义主题创建

在custom/themes目录下创建个人主题文件,参考现有主题的语法结构。从简单的颜色调整开始,逐步添加个性化元素。

插件搭配优化

结合Git插件、自动补全插件等,让你的终端不仅美观,功能也更加完善。

总结建议

终端美化是一个循序渐进的过程,建议从简单的主题开始尝试,逐步找到最适合自己工作习惯的风格。记住,最好的主题是那个能让你工作效率最高、使用最舒适的那一款。

希望这些推荐能帮助你打造一个既美观又实用的终端环境!🎨✨🚀

【免费下载链接】ohmyzsh项目地址: https://gitcode.com/gh_mirrors/ohmy/ohmyzsh

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/26 22:53:36

如何快速扩展gofakeit:开发者的完整实践指南

如何快速扩展gofakeit:开发者的完整实践指南 【免费下载链接】gofakeit Random fake data generator written in go 项目地址: https://gitcode.com/gh_mirrors/go/gofakeit 想要为你的Go项目生成更丰富的测试数据?gofakeit作为强大的随机数据生成…

作者头像 李华
网站建设 2026/6/26 20:54:15

MLX转换终极指南:在Apple芯片上实现一键部署的完整教程

MLX转换终极指南:在Apple芯片上实现一键部署的完整教程 【免费下载链接】mlx-examples 在 MLX 框架中的示例。 项目地址: https://gitcode.com/GitHub_Trending/ml/mlx-examples 想要在Mac上获得300%的推理速度提升?厌倦了PyTorch模型在Apple芯片…

作者头像 李华
网站建设 2026/6/25 10:37:35

实战指南:用Docker快速搭建专业级语音合成服务

实战指南:用Docker快速搭建专业级语音合成服务 【免费下载链接】MeloTTS 项目地址: https://gitcode.com/GitHub_Trending/me/MeloTTS 还在为开发语音应用而头疼吗?想象一下,你的应用需要支持中英法日韩多种语言的文本转语音功能&…

作者头像 李华
网站建设 2026/7/1 20:55:33

15个Obsidian效率提升的完整方案:让你的知识管理达到新高度

15个Obsidian效率提升的完整方案:让你的知识管理达到新高度 【免费下载链接】awesome-obsidian 🕶️ Awesome stuff for Obsidian 项目地址: https://gitcode.com/gh_mirrors/aw/awesome-obsidian 想要彻底优化你的Obsidian使用体验,让…

作者头像 李华
网站建设 2026/6/23 19:30:09

一键部署:ZLMediaKit Windows服务化实战指南

一键部署:ZLMediaKit Windows服务化实战指南 【免费下载链接】ZLMediaKit 基于C11的WebRTC/RTSP/RTMP/HTTP/HLS/HTTP-FLV/WebSocket-FLV/HTTP-TS/HTTP-fMP4/WebSocket-TS/WebSocket-fMP4/GB28181/SRT服务器和客户端框架。 项目地址: https://gitcode.com/GitHub_T…

作者头像 李华